This may not be a limitation of network manager. I hit something similar today while trying to do two-factor auth:
If I use this command line: sudo openvpn --config client.ovpn --auth- retry interact, I am prompted for my username, password, then when auth "fails" I am prompted for my second-factor key. However, if I add this: "--auth-user-pass up" the first part of auth succeeds, but when it "fails" due to the second factor, instead of falling back to "interact" it just fails and tries to auth all over.
